Vtg Japanese Buddhist Altar Fitting Scroll
This is a Japanese vintage fabric and paper hanging scroll (Owakigake) representing Jusanbutsu, the 13 Buddhas. It is an icon displayed in Japanese Buddhist home altars, Butsudan. It is a powerful religious image, aimed to be at the center of an altar. This Owakigake is gold and dark blue with red accents. It is embellished with metal parts on the bottom.
